BLM Firefighter Killed in Routine Tree Removal

Grand Junction, Colo.

A Bureau of Land Management firefighter is killed during a routine hazard-tree removal project.
29-year-old Brett Stearns was killed yesterday while trying to remove a tree at Freeman Reservoir, about 15 miles northeast of Craig.
Stearns was working on the project with about 12 other B-L-M firefighters when he was struck by a falling tree at approximately 4:30 in the afternoon.
He was pronounced dead at the scene.
The accident is currently under investigation.
